]> git.apps.os.sepia.ceph.com Git - ceph.git/commitdiff
rgw: json_encode json a bit differently
authorYehuda Sadeh <yehuda@inktank.com>
Tue, 14 May 2013 19:25:17 +0000 (12:25 -0700)
committerYehuda Sadeh <yehuda@inktank.com>
Tue, 14 May 2013 19:25:17 +0000 (12:25 -0700)
Encode map as a list, it's a more friendly representation.

Signed-off-by: Yehuda Sadeh <yehuda@inktank.com>
src/rgw/rgw_json_enc.cc

index 2094b5cb3727aa2de8d493e3e3a24addb818ca84..7426e33102bfcaa3ffeef7f316c8b5caef0ad394 100644 (file)
@@ -507,7 +507,7 @@ void RGWRegion::dump(Formatter *f) const
   encode_json("is_master", is_master, f);
   encode_json("endpoints", endpoints, f);
   encode_json("master_zone", master_zone, f);
-  encode_json("zones", zones, f);
+  encode_json_map("zones", zones, f); /* more friendly representation */
 }
 
 static void decode_zones(map<string, RGWZone>& zones, JSONObj *o)